概括
这项研究引入了一种新的干扰度法,用于精确,同时测量液晶 (LC) 层厚度和双折. 该技术为先进的LC细胞分析提供了空间分辨率,电压依赖的表征.

背景情况:
- 描述液晶 (LC) 层需要精确测量厚度和双断度.
- 现有的方法通常依赖于以点为基础的或平均的测量,限制空间分辨率.
- 电压依赖的光电特性对于LC设备的性能至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 开发一种全场干扰度方法,用于同时测量LC层中的厚度变形和双折.
- 为了克服基于点或平均的测量技术的局限性.
- 为了使空间分辨率,电压依赖的LC电池的特征.
主要方法:
- 使用马赫-泽恩德干扰仪与时间相位移 (TPS) 相结合.
- 使用零电压参考数据对几何厚度变化进行了新的校正.
- 用LC 6CHBT材料和变形形状的数值模型验证了该方法.
主要成果:
- 在实验方法和数值模型之间实现了高一致性 (R2 = 0.999991).
- 从不均的LC样本中证明了精确的双断提取.
- 成功地绘制了单像素和复杂的LC结构的光电特性.
结论:
- 开发的干扰测量技术提供了强大的和精确的LC细胞的特征.
- 该方法可以准确地绘制空间不均的光电特性.
- 这一进步促进了液晶设备的详细分析和优化.

Leveling Equipment
As leveling involves measuring vertical distances relative to a horizontal line of sight, it requires a graduated rod, called a level rod, for vertical measurements and an instrument called a level for a horizontal sight line. A level includes a high-powered telescope with a mechanism for leveling to ensure the line of sight is horizontal when the bubble in the spirit level is centered. Influence of Earth's Curvature and Atmospheric Refraction on Leveling
During leveling, the Earth's curvature and atmospheric refraction introduce deviations in the line of sight from a true horizontal reference. When the line of sight is leveled, it remains perpendicular to the plumb line only at a single point. Beyond this, it deviates due to the Earth’s curvature, represented by the correction C.
